About this book

Written by acknowledged leaders in this field, this book not only fills a 40 year gap in the literature, but presents a markedly changed field with new approaches, outlooks, and findings. The chapter authors provide a thorough discussion of the physiology and molecular biology of the membrane transporters. Each chapter reviews everything from the basic anatomy and ecophysiology to the molecular mechanisms and control.

Contents

Solutes, Solutions, and Membrane Transporters. Cell Volume Regulation. Protozoa. Mollusca. Annelids. Crustacea. Fishes. Amphibia. Reptiles. Birds. Mammals. Insects. Retrospectiv: What We Have Learned; What We Need to Know.
